Default Squeaky Brembos?

Wanted to get some opinions of those with the stock brembo brakes. I've only put about 300 miles on my car so far, and obviously know these are performance brakes, but are they supposed to squeak rather loudly when you are coming to a stop? Maybe i have to put more miles on them for break-in time, but just curious of any others have this happen. Also, its been rather cold still around here so weather might be a factor?

My 06 Z have squeaky brembos as well.

Mine has over 11,000 km on it and it still squeaks. It happens just as you come to a complete stop, below 5 mph and when the brake paddle is depressed at a certain depth. If I step on it deeper or release the paddle a bit, it goes away.

It squeaks with the OEM brembo rotors and also with the brembo sport cross drilled rotors. Another observation I found is that it does not squeak when I start driving. It happens after the brakes are warmed up with regular city traffic.

I am hoping it will eventually go away or when I wear out the stock pads and go with something else.

Any ideas to fix this? Brake disc cleaner maybe?
